Hot Toys T2 Sarah Connor Review II

Having reviewed its box and contents in the previous post, here's Hot Toys T2 Sarah Connor 1/6 scale collectible figure fully kitted out in her shades, tank top and enhanced tactical load bearing vest with four magazine pouches, tactical web belt with combat knife in sheath, military style pants and combat boots. Sarah is armed with her SR-16 M4 Stoner Assault Rifle (or Colt Commando CAR-15 carbine)


In the movie "Terminator 2: Judgment Day", at a outlying farm in the desert, Sarah had used her knife to carve the words "NO FATE" into a wooden table to remind herself what Kyle Reese had told her ten years ago, "The future is not set. There is no fate but what we make for ourselves."

Sarah then arms herself with a SR-16 M4 Stoner Assault Rifle (or Colt Commando CAR-15 carbine) and a Detonics 1911 custom pistol taken out of the armory from the Mojave desert in an attempt to assassinate Miles Dyson (Joe Morton) when she learns he started the project which lead to the machines being built.









And here's more close-ups of Hot Toys Sarah Connor (Linda Hamilton headsculpt) with her 1/6 scale sunglasses




And here's a close-up of the very detailed enhanced tactical load bearing vest with four magazine pouches (two on each side). The assault vest is very well produced with all the fine stitching and working straps



Sarah tucks her Detonics Custom 1911 pistol into the back of her pants since the weapon did not come with a holster. Note the ultra detailed military web belt or tactical belt.


And her handy Combat Knife kept in the black leather sheath by her right side, ready to be used at a drop of a hat


And here's Hot Toys T2 Sarah Connor letting it rip with her SR-16 M4 Stoner Assault Rifle (or Colt Commando CAR-15 carbine) with flash hider      




Close-ups of the Hot Toys 1/6 scale SR-16 M4 Stoner Assault Rifle (or Colt Commando CAR-15 carbine) with flash hider, laser pointer and ACOG scope





Once Sarah has arrived at the Dyson residence, she removes the flash hider and adds a sound suppressor, along with a laser pointer and an ACOG scope. She sets up her silenced gun behind the swimming pool, where she can see Miles working on his computer, unaware of the danger outside. Sarah loads the rifle and takes aim, pointing a red laser at the back of Miles head.

Hot Toys effed up on the carbine. Sarah in the movie used a mock XM177E2 made from a Colt Sporter II carbine chopped down and converted to full auto, but the figure has an M4 carbine (note the round forward assist button, brass deflector behind the ejection port, and most obviously the detachable carry handle) with an XM177 flash hider. Hell, you can even still see the M203 barrel grove, though their attempt to cover it up with the laser sight is pretty clever.
